在汽车工业飞速发展的今天,车载操作系统(VOS,Vehicle Operating System)已经成为汽车智能化的重要组成部分。对于新手来说,了解车载操作系统的基础知识到其在实际应用中的体现,是迈向汽车智能化的重要一步。本文将从基础概念、技术架构、应用案例等多个角度,为你全面解析车载操作系统。
一、车载操作系统的定义与作用
1. 定义
车载操作系统,顾名思义,是用于控制和管理车载电子设备的软件系统。它类似于个人电脑的操作系统,负责管理车载设备之间的资源分配、任务调度、数据交换等。
2. 作用
车载操作系统的主要作用包括:
- 资源管理:合理分配车载设备资源,确保系统稳定运行。
- 任务调度:根据优先级,合理调度各个任务,提高系统响应速度。
- 数据交换:实现车载设备之间的数据传输和共享。
- 人机交互:提供用户界面,方便驾驶员和乘客进行操作。
二、车载操作系统的技术架构
1. 硬件平台
车载操作系统需要运行在特定的硬件平台上,主要包括:
- 处理器:负责执行操作系统指令,处理数据。
- 存储器:用于存储操作系统和应用程序。
- 通信接口:实现车载设备之间的数据传输。
2. 软件层次
车载操作系统的软件层次主要包括:
- 内核:负责资源管理和任务调度。
- 中间件:提供跨平台、跨语言的服务,如网络通信、数据库等。
- 应用层:提供各种车载应用程序,如导航、娱乐等。
三、车载操作系统的应用案例
1. 智能驾驶
车载操作系统在智能驾驶领域发挥着重要作用,如:
- ADAS(高级驾驶辅助系统):通过车载摄像头、雷达等传感器,实时监测车辆周围环境,为驾驶员提供辅助驾驶功能。
- 自动驾驶:通过车载操作系统,实现车辆的自主感知、决策和执行。
2. 车联网
车载操作系统在车联网领域同样具有重要意义,如:
- 车与车通信(V2V):实现车辆之间的实时信息交换,提高行车安全。
- 车与基础设施通信(V2I):实现车辆与交通基础设施的信息交互,优化交通流量。
3. 娱乐与信息娱乐
车载操作系统在娱乐与信息娱乐领域也有所应用,如:
- 车载娱乐系统:提供音乐、视频、游戏等娱乐功能。
- 导航系统:为驾驶员提供实时路况、路线规划等服务。
四、总结
车载操作系统作为汽车智能化的重要组成部分,对于新手来说,了解其基础知识到实际应用至关重要。本文从定义、技术架构、应用案例等方面,全面解析了车载操作系统,希望能为你提供有益的参考。随着汽车智能化的发展,车载操作系统将发挥越来越重要的作用。
